THE 15 BEST INTERNATIONAL FILM SCHOOLS

AUSTRALIAN FILM TELEVISION AND RADIO SCHOOL

AUSTRALIA

AFTRS counts a who’s who of regional cinema among its alumni — Oscar-winning auteur Jane Campion (The Piano) and Hollywood director Phillip Noyce (Patriot Games) are grads — and offers industry-driven programs covering every aspect of filmmaking. Its On Country Pathways Program trains emerging First Nations creators in remote communities.

BEIJING FILM ACADEMY

CHINA

The academy grants bachelor’s, master’s and even Ph.D. degrees in film, and virtually every major Chinese filmmaker has passed through its halls, including Zhang Yimou (Raise the Red Lantern) and Chen Kaige (Farewell My Concubine).

ECAM

SPAIN

Spain is one of the few regions that can boast of a production boom — Netflix has invested heavily in the country — and Madrid-based ECAM has been one of the main beneficiaries. Their school-to-studio pipeline is exemplified by Goya-winning director-writer team Rodrigo Sorogoyen and Isabel Peña, who met at ECAM and went on to produce the acclaimed Spanish series Antidisturbios.

ESCAC

SPAIN

Catalan’s premium film and TV training ground — located in the city of Terrassa, north of Barcelona — boasts Oscar nominee Juan Antonio Bayona (Society of the Snow, The Impossible) among its alumni and prides itself on a balance of film theory and practical training. The school also offers a one-year introductory filmmaking course in English and a bilingual stunt academy.

FAMU PRAGUE

CZECH REPUBLIC

Two-time Oscar winner Milos Forman (Amadeus) and Polish auteur Agnieszka Holland (Green Border) are grads of FAMU, which remains the gold standard of European film schools and includes accredited programs in English in directing and scriptwriting.

HONG KONG ACADEMY FOR PERFORMING ARTS

HONG KONG

Hong Kong’s premier performing arts conservatory offers practice-based programs in directing, acting, cinematography, producing and more. Uniquely interdisciplinary, the academy brings together filmmakers, actors, musicians and designers under one roof.

KOREAN ACADEMY OF FILM ARTS

SOUTH KOREA

KAFA has been a springboard for the nation’s cinematic New Wave since its founding by the Korean Film Council in 1984. The elite two-year academy keeps class sizes small (about 30 students) and offers intensive training in directing, cinematography, producing and animation. Parasite director Bong Joon Ho is a KAFA graduate who went on to win Korea’s first Palme d’Or and Oscar.

LONDON FILM SCHOOL

U.K.

London Film School alumni did more than just shine at this year’s Cannes Film Festival, as Carla Simón debuted the poignant Romería and Oliver Hermanus grabbed attention with the buzzy gay romance The History of Sound. In June, news broke that LFS has officially partnered with the prestigious Nicholl Fellowships in Screenwriting.

NATIONAL FILM AND TELEVISION SCHOOL

U.K.

NFTS highlights from the last year include a 10 million pound ($13.5 million) government commitment to expand its historic campus, four NFTS alumni nominated at this year’s Oscars and a history-making Cannes Film Festival world premiere of Ether — the only time a first-year student has secured a debut on the Croisette.

SAM SPIEGEL FILM SCHOOL

ISRAEL

The country’s premier film school continued with its program for Palestinian and Arabic-speaking students, now in its fourth year, ensuring Sam Spiegel remains one of the only institutions in the region where Jewish, Muslim and Christian students — both Israeli and Palestinian — study, live and create side by side.

TOKYO UNIVERSITY OF THE ARTS

JAPAN

Geidai (as the school is nicknamed) emphasizes cross- disciplinary collaboration, with student directors, animators and composers working together on projects. Notable recent alumni include Oscar-winning filmmaker Ryusuke Hamaguchi (Drive My Car).

TORONTO FILM SCHOOL

CANADA

With local production booming, TFS’ continuing focus on below-the-line film and TV talent this year included a $2.5 million collaboration with Sony Canada, allowing students to work with new cameras and production gear in the classroom before reaching U.S. production hubs for major streamers in Toronto.

UNIVERSIDAD DE CINE

ARGENTINA

Arguably the best film school in South America, the Buenos Aires institution offers undergraduate degrees in everything from directing and producing to scriptwriting and animation, though applicants from non-Spanish-speaking countries need to provide a B2 level Spanish language certificate to be considered.

VANCOUVER FILM SCHOOL

CANADA

During the 2025 awards season, VFS boasted 107 alumni credits at the Oscars and 398 at the Emmys. New additions to VFS include foley artist Diane Schimpl joining as a sound design instructor.

VICTORIA UNIVERSITY OF WELLINGTON (TE HERENGA WAKA)

NEW ZEALAND

Victoria University of Wellington has emerged as a rising force in film education thanks to its Miramar Creative Centre — a purpose-built facility launched in 2017 in partnership with Peter Jackson‘s Weta and Park Road studios. Coursework spans directing, VFX and animation, with master’s degrees that draw on the country’s Hollywood-connected screen sector. — M.G.
